print "%e"%number
转载 2023-07-13 15:57:54
161阅读
在处理json时,有一个字段是数字并且位数很长,结果被处理为科学计数...,"tradeId":101200111072902276000243,...经过json.decode之后取到的tradeId是1.012001110729e+23尝试各种方法之后只能通过字符串替换解决,利用正则表达式if not (string.find(str, '"tradeId"') == nil) then
转载 2023-05-25 09:06:04
976阅读
excel计算出现1E+06如图,请问什么意思?这是科学计数,表示1乘以10 的6次方,通常是显示数位不够时这样显示。用科学计算器计算出现e是什么意思就是error错误的意思,可能计算没意义(例如6/0)或超出范围(例如10^60*10^40),按左或右或AC。计算器计算出得数3.0571428571428571428571428571429e-4什么意思这个e表示的是10的多少次方,e-4就是
科学计数科学技术科学家用来表示很大或很小的数字的一种方便的方法,其满足正则表达式 [±][1-9].[0-9]+E[±][0-9]+,即数字的整数部分只有 1 位,小数部分至少有 1 位,该数字及其指数部分的正负号即使对正数也必定明确给出。现以科学计数的格式给出实数 A,请编写程序按普通数字表示输出 A,并保证所有有效位都被保留。输入格式: 每个输入包含 1 个测试用例,即一个以科学
转载 2023-06-04 15:25:26
248阅读
JavaScript 中经常会碰到数值计算问题,偶尔会在不经意间报一个不是bug的bug。今天来说说一个特殊的例子。我以0.0011BTC 价格买入 0.0002CZR 计算出了的金额是 0.00000022BTC,而 JavaScript 计算出来的金额是 2.2e-7 。值是对的,只是用了科学计数,也是数值类型。但是问题来了,一般用户用户看不懂 2.2e-7,那
题目描述:科学计数科学家用来表示很大或很小的数字的一种方便的方法,其满足正则表达式 [+-][1-9].[0-9]+E[+-][0-9]+,即数字的整数部分只有 1 位,小数部分至少有 1 位,该数字及其指数部分的正负号即使对正数也必定明确给出。现以科学计数的格式给出实数 A,请编写程序按普通数字表示输出 A,并保证所有有效位都被保留。输入格式:每个输入包含 1 个测试
问题——————科学计数科学家用来表示很大或很小的数字的一种方便的方法,其满足正则表达式 [+-][1-9].[0-9]+E[+-][0-9]+,即数字的整数部分只有 1 位,小数部分至少有 1 位,该数字及其指数部分的正负号即使对正数也必定明确给出。现以科学计数的格式给出实数 A,请编写程序按普通数字表示输出 A,并保证所有有效位都被保留。输入格式:每个输入包含 1
一、很大的整数会被自动科学计数处理的解决办法    php里如果一个很大的整数,比如 3971521131315242(实际我们在应用中并没有想把它当做整数,而是想把它当做字符串),但在PHP里当一个变量被赋值这些大数后,会被自动科学计数处理成:3.9710611419955E+15    而这个处理有时是在我们不
转载 2024-08-11 21:53:02
414阅读
# Python中科学计数复原 在科学计数中,我们经常会遇到很大或者很小的数字,例如1.23e-4表示1.23乘以10的-4次方,即0.000123。在科学领域,这种表示方法非常常见。在Python中,我们可以使用科学计数来表示和处理这些大或小的数字。本文将介绍如何在Python中使用科学计数,并演示如何将科学计数的数字复原为普通的十进制数。 ## 1. 科学计数表示 在Pyth
原创 2023-08-23 04:23:22
260阅读
首先是从Excel里面读数据的时候,Excel里面的数据是数字,太大,其实也不是数字,就是个银行卡号,复制进去,就自动成数字啦,然后就变成科学计数啦,在使用poi读取数据的时候,读出来的就是科学计数的数字,tostring之后,就不是我们想要的数据啦,这是一种情况。 还有一种情况,就是Excel里面的小数比如,1.2读出来可能就是1.19999,这个
您是否尝试阅读和理解Java的String 格式文档?我发现它几乎无法穿透。尽管它确实包含所有信息,但该组织仍有一些不足之处。本指南旨在使您更清楚并简化Java中字符串格式的使用。字符串格式在Java中格式化字符串的最常见方法是使用String.format()。如果有一个“ java sprintf”,那就是它。String output = String.format("%s =
2.4 数据类型详解2.4.1 数值类型说明示例int整数100,-5float浮点数3.14,2.0,2e+5(科学计数,2*105 )bool布尔型True(等同于1,表示肯定), False(等同于0,表示否定)complex复数2+3j,1j(虚部的系数为1的时候必须写1,否则j会被当作变量j)print(2e+5) #科学计数,浮点数 200000.0 print(2.0-1.
浮点数是采用科学计数来表示的,由符合位、有效数字位、指数三部分组成。科学计数-3.14*105,- 是符号位,3.14是有效数字,5是指数。科学计数来的有效数字为从第1个非零数字开始的全部数字,指数决定小数点的位置,符号表示该数的正负。浮点数表示IEEE754标准规定了4种浮点数类型:单精度、双精度、延伸单精度、延伸双精度。这里主要讲解单精度和双精度。这里需要注意,浮点数无法精确表示0值,所
DecimalFormat format = (DecimalFormat) NumberFormat.getPercentInstance(); format.applyPattern("#####0"); double strCell = aCell.getN temp = format...
原创 2023-06-15 00:31:15
110阅读
一,Python5种数据类型汇总;python的五种基本类型 分别有 整数 , 浮点数 , 布尔值 ,字符串 , 空;整数就是由基本数值来表示 比如: 100 300 20 等等;浮点数有两种表达方式 1 基本表达 比如:3.14 等有小数点的数值; 2 科学计数 比如: 314e-2 e-2意为除以10的2次方 314/100=3.14 0.314e1 e1意为乘以10的1次方 0.314
一、java科学计数形式是什么?科学计数:5.12E2(既5.12*10^2读作:5.12乘10的2次方),且E是不区分大小写的,也可以写作5.12e2。         只有浮点型的数字才能直接使用科学计数形式表示。二、java科学计数的使用1.java语言浮点型默认是double;小技巧(示例): 1.下划
基本数据类型整数类型整数类型有四种进制表示 默认情况,整数采用十进制,其他进制去要加引导符进制种类引导符号十进制无 例如:1010,-1010八进制0o或0O 例如:0o1010二进制0b或0B 例如:0b1010十六进制0x或0X 例如:0X1010注意:16进制由字符0-9,a-f或A-F组成十进制就是逢十进一,几进制就是逢几进一浮点类型浮点数有两种表示方法:十进制和科学计数,除此以外不能用
科学计数科学家用来表示很大或很小的数字的一种方便的方法,其满足正则表达式 [+-][1-9].[0-9]+E[+-][0-9]+,即数字的整数部分只有 1 位,小数部分至少有 1 位,该数字及其指数部分的正负号即使对正数也必定明确给出。现以科学计数的格式给出实数 A,请编写程序按普通数字表示输出 A,并保证所有有效位都被保留。输入格式:每个输入包含 1 个测试用例,即一
1024 科学计数 (20分) 科学计数科学家用来表示很大或很小的数字的一种方便的方法,其满足正则表达式 [±][1-9].[0-9]+E[±][0-9]+,即数字的整数部分只有 1 位,小数部分至少有 1 位,该数字及其指数部分的正负号即使对正数也必定明确给出。现以科学计数的格式给出实数 A,请编写程序按普通数字表示输出 A,并保证所有有效位都被保留。输入格式: 每个输入包含 1 个测
前面介绍了整型数据类型,用于存储整型数据。现实问题中不但有整型数值,还有小数。Java语言也提供了针对小数的存储类型,分别是float类型和double类型。Java语言的浮点类型有两种不同的表示形式:十进制数和科学计数。十进制数形式,由数字和小数点组成,且必须有小数点,如0.123、12.85、26.98等;科学计数形式,如:2.1E5、3.7e-2等。其中e或E之前必须有数字,且e或E后面
  • 1
  • 2
  • 3
  • 4
  • 5